Video: How to live a greener life

From pensions to packed lunches, there are so many ways to live a more sustainable life. We gathered a range of experts for a look at all the options

09 February 2022

Recorded shortly after the COP26 summit, this webinar brings together pioneers and ambassadors of sustainable living – including writer, director and Comic Relief co-founder Richard Curtis. Richard is now co-founder and director of financial campaign group Make My Money Matter.

Other guests include TV presenter Tom Heap, horticulturalist and broadcaster Poppy Okotcha, photojournalist Aditi Mayer and Smart Solutions director Chris Carberry.

They’ve all identified ways you can make small but important changes in your lifestyle to help in the fight against climate change.

From diets to household waste, energy efficiency to personal finance, you’ll hear about real, practical measures you can take to live more sustainably.
